For the incoming director's review.

Beginning next quarter, Farrowgate will replace flat-rate commissions with a tiered model: 4% base, rising to 7% above quota, with accelerators for the Quillon product family. Modeling by the Denver-replacement office in Ashmere suggests a 3% cost increase offset by projected volume gains. Clawback terms remain unchanged. Regional leads have reviewed the draft and raised no material objections.

The confidential context on forward business plans is set out below.

internal memo for kawip-hadug: Headcount on the Wenwyn team goes from 7 to 140 by the end of January. Gross margin on Wenwyn came in at 20 percent against a plan of 15 percent.

Overnight, about 120 exports to the Winterholt archive failed with timeout errors; I've confirmed it's the archive's ingestion node, not our serializer. I enabled the exponential backoff patch on the retry worker — retries now cap at six attempts with jitter, so don't re-run the manual replay script, it will double-submit. The dead-letter queue should drain itself by morning; anything still stuck after 9:00 needs manual inspection. Future maintainers with questions about the backoff change can reach me at the address below.

Best,
Arno

escalation mailbox, hadug-bajog: sormir@norvalabs.internal

**Night Shift — Recording Studio (Room 4B)**

The Fennick Media training studio runs unattended overnight. Check the booking sheet before entering. Power down lights and teleprompter after any maintenance. Do not move camera rigs; they are marked on the floor. Report faults in the night log, not by phone. Lock the equipment cage before leaving. The studio door uses a keypad; enter with the code below.

badge for fahap-kahof: bdg-EQUNTN-00774017

## Service Accounts: BranchReaper Bot

For this week's sync: the stale-branch cleanup bot (BranchReaper) now runs under its own service account instead of borrowing CI credentials. It scans the Copperfield monorepo nightly, flags branches idle past 60 days, and opens deletion PRs with a seven-day grace window. Permissions are scoped to branch metadata and PR creation only — no force-push rights. Anyone reproducing bot behavior locally needs to authenticate against the internal repo-admin service using the key that follows.

gateway credential: kto23_LX9A4ys6i4nzHtpOLNLodKK